Volunteer/Ministry
Opportunities
The ministry of Doors of
Hope depends on volunteers who have responded
to the leading of the
Lord.There are many opportunities for service and
everyone who
desires to help can find a way to do so. Volunteer
training is provided.
Peer Counselor
Provides one-on-one peer
counseling at the Center. Each peer counselor volunteers
4 hours one day a week
at the Center. New volunteer training of 5 -3 hour
sessions is required as
vital preparation.
Prayer Ministry
Intercedes for
counselors, individual clients, finances of the center and
its needs in general.
Does not require coming
to the Center, but becoming familiar with the Center
and the individuals
involved would be beneficial in prayer support.
Volunteer
Receptionist
Performs general front
office duties, answering the phone and greeting the
clients.
This position requires 4
hours one day a week. Training is provided.
Mommy Store
Assists with overall
maintenance which includes sorting and laundering
of clothes as they are
donated to the Center, and the displaying and
straightening of
clothes, toys, furniture items, etc.
Church Representative
Acts as a liaison
between the local pastor, the church and the center
keeping
them updated as to
programs, events and needs.
Special Projects
Helps with special
projects and fund raising events. Examples: Help prepare
bulk mailings
and newsletters, helpers
for the annual dinner/dessert auction, walk for life, baby
bottle campaigns, booths
at special events, and other events.
P.A.S.S
Leads small groups of
women suffering from post-abortion syndrome through a
twelve
week Bible study to
promote help and healing. Requirement: Must have attended
a
P.A.S.S. study as a
participant prior to leading a group.
Volunteer nurses and
sonographers
Provide limited
ultrasounds and verification of pregnancy when the Center
begins to offer these
services. Training will be provided. |
